Multi-step reaction with 9 steps
1: 66 percent / imidazole / dimethylformamide / 4 h / 47 °C
2: 100 percent / toluene / 12 h / Heating
3: thionyl chloride, pyridine / tetrahydrofuran / 0.75 h / -40 - -20 °C
4: 6.5 g / pyridine / dimethylformamide / 2 h / 80 °C
5: triethylamine / CH2Cl2 / 1 h / 0 °C
6: 51 percent / tetrahydrofuran; diethyl ether / 0.33 h / 0 °C
7: 69 percent / hydroquinone / xylene / 3.5 h / 130 °C
8: 25 percent / glacial acetic acid, tetra-n-butylammonium fluoride / tetrahydrofuran / 48 h / Ambient temperature
9: 30 percent / triphenylphosphine, potassium 2-ethylhexanoate, tetrakis(triphenylphosphine)palladium / ethyl acetate; CH2Cl2 / 0.08 h
With
pyridine; 1H-imidazole; tetrakis(triphenylphosphine) palladium(0); thionyl chloride; tetrabutyl ammonium fluoride; potassium 2-ethylhexanoate; acetic acid; triethylamine; hydroquinone; triphenylphosphine;
In
tetrahydrofuran; diethyl ether; dichloromethane; ethyl acetate; N,N-dimethyl-formamide; toluene; xylene;
DOI:10.1021/jm00388a022
